Originariamente parte del grande magazzino Dawson’s, Maxwell’s Café Bar è stato completato nel 2002 e da allora ha riscosso un grande successo, diventando un locale molto amato sia dai residenti che dai turisti. Nel corso degli anni, Maxwell’s si è ampliato aggiungendo un’area esterna riscaldata e una terrazza all’aperto sul tetto, offrendo ai clienti l’opportunità di godersi al massimo i mesi estivi. Qui da Maxwell’s ci impegniamo a creare un’atmosfera rilassata e accogliente, accompagnata da ottimi vini, cibo di qualità e un servizio eccellente.
